Cairo, Egypt. c. 22 November 1943. Outdoors group portrait at a conference at which officials, military leaders and the heads of the government of the United States, China and England conferred. Back row, left to right: General (Gen) Shang Chen, Foreign Affairs expert of the Chinese Army; Lieutenant General (Lt Gen) Ling Wei; Lt Gen Brehon Somervell, Chief US Army Service of Supply; Lt Gen Joseph W. Stilwell, Commander of US Army Forces in China, India and Burma; Gen Henry Arnold, Chief of US Army Air Forces; Field Marshal Sir John Dill; Admiral Louis Mountbatten, Allied Commander-in-Chief in the Far East; Major General Carton de Wiart of the British General Staff. Front row: Generalissimo Chiang Kai-shek; President Franklin D. Roosevelt; Prime Minister Winston Churchill; Madame Chiang.
